About М. Д. Носков
М. Д. Носков is a scholar working on Electrical and Electronic Engineering, Materials Chemistry, Astronomy and Astrophysics, Computational Mechanics and Atomic and Molecular Physics, and Optics, having authored 41 papers that have together received 343 indexed citations. Recurring topics across this work include Power Transformer Diagnostics and Insulation (22 papers), High voltage insulation and dielectric phenomena (18 papers), Lightning and Electromagnetic Phenomena (5 papers), Theoretical and Computational Physics (4 papers), Electrohydrodynamics and Fluid Dynamics (3 papers), Electrostatic Discharge in Electronics (3 papers), Vacuum and Plasma Arcs (3 papers) and Enhanced Oil Recovery Techniques (2 papers). The work is most often cited by research in Astronomy and Astrophysics (78 citations), Materials Chemistry (182 citations), Electrical and Electronic Engineering (190 citations), Ocean Engineering (45 citations) and Fluid Flow and Transfer Processes (14 citations). М. Д. Носков has collaborated with scholars based in Russia, Germany and United States. Frequent co-authors include A.J. Schwab, A. Malinovski, В. В. Лопатин, M. Sack, Mitchell D. Smooke, А. В. Шаповалов, K. A. Wright, C. M. Cooke, K. Kist and Michele Benzi. Their work appears in journals such as IEEE Transactions on Dielectrics and Electrical Insulation, Journal of Physics D Applied Physics, Journal of Computational Physics, Physica A Statistical Mechanics and its Applications and Journal of Applied Physics.
